About reservoirs in AMAZONAS
As of July 28, 2026, the reservoirs we track across AMAZONAS that report live levels hold roughly 14,748 hm³ of water — about 36.6% of their combined capacity. Taken together, AMAZONAS's reservoirs are low.
Across the region, 1 is low. SAO MANOEL is the fullest at 101.4%, while JIRAU is the lowest at 27.1%.
Over the most recent week on record, 4 reservoirs rose and 5 reservoirs fell across AMAZONAS.
Storage figures for AMAZONAS come from ONS; the most recent reading is from July 28, 2026. Each reservoir below links to its own page with full history and seasonal context.
